The N96 improves on the N95 8 GB with the addition of a DVB-H digital TV tuner with DVR functionality (useless in the US, unfortunately), 16 GB of built-in flash storage in addition to expandable micro-SDHC, and a dual ultra-bright LED flash. There’s still no camera lens cover, however.
